PostPosted: Wed Mar 20, 2013 8:09 pm    Post subject: Please ELI5 how to do triplets in the bar editor. Reply with quote

I'd like to make 8th note triplets... not sure how,

Place a note on beat 1 and the next 2 boxes. Now click "SHUFFLE" for the last two notes.

My fault, was thinking of an earlier version. Please highlight the note, right click on it and select 'Forced' under 'Shuffle' in the event menu.
